TXM Recruit is partnering with a prominent automation and intralogistics company to hire an experienced Site Manager to oversee a fast-paced automated distribution facility. This role will involve maintaining relations with clients, management of engineers, budget management and much more. The ideal candidate does not need to have worked in this industry, just a good engineering and managing background.
Working Hours: 40 Hours per week (08:00 - 17:00)
Key Responsibilities:
- Overall management of the site.
- Promote a strong safety culture and compliance to current H&S standards.
- Provide complete customer satisfaction whilst enhancing the reputation of the Company.
- Strategically plan and manage site budgets and associated commercial activities.
- Responsible for reacting to electro-mechanical tasks.
- Manage, as the on-site representative, all system improvements and installations.
- Manage all training requirements, both technical and regulatory.
- Develop on-site staff and resources.
- Take a leading role relating to escalation management.
- Increase the scope and efficiency of the Company's support solutions.
Skills and Qualifications Required:
- HNC/D NVQ LEVEL 5 and/or relevant higher engineering qualification.
- Operational experience within an automated distribution or manufacturing facility.
- Experience of managing teams of 5.
- Strong experience of Lean / 6 Sigma.
- Technical skills to cover software systems, with a good appreciation of electro-mechanical installations.
- Customer focused with excellent verbal and written communication skills.
- Experience with CMMS.
- NEBOSH Managing Safety qualification desirable.
- Strong data analytical and report development skills.
- Team oriented.
- Deal with issues and resolve them diplomatically.
- Proven organisational skills.
